In Hoai An, Vietnam, the average temperature for July hovers around 30°C (85°F), making it a warm destination. Expect temperatures to range from a comfortable 24°C (76°F) at night to a sizzling 36°C (97°F) during the day. However, prepare for some rain, as the area experiences an average precipitation of 107 mm (4.2 in) over 16 days in the month, and the humidity can reach a high of 85%. How July Weather in Hoai An Compares to Other Months

Weather in Hoai An var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Hoai An,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Hoai An,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ather23°C (74°F)80 mm (3.1 inches)86%extreme
February Weather23°C (74°F)44 mm (1.7 inches)83%extreme
March Weather26°C (78°F)39 mm (1.5 inches)78%extreme
April Weather27°C (81°F)64 mm (2.5 inches)75%extreme
May Weather29°C (84°F)132 mm (5.2 inches)80%extreme
June Weather30°C (86°F)84 mm (3.3 inches)85%extreme
July Weather30°C (85°F)107 mm (4.2 inches)85%extreme
August Weather30°C (85°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)87%extreme
September Weather28°C (83°F)214 mm (8.4 inches)88%extreme
October Weather27°C (80°F)349 mm (13.8 inches)90%extreme
November Weather25°C (78°F)442 mm (17.4 inches)91%extreme
December Weather23°C (75°F)239 mm (9.4 inches)89%very high
